According to the International Chamber of Commerce Commission on Marketing and Advertising, ethical advertising should be "honest, legal, decent, and truthful," and should provide "quick and easy redress when transgressions occur." The ICC also enjoins advertisers to be socially responsible … WebVirtue ethics. Virtue ethics views marketing ethics from the perspective of the moral integrity of the individual(s) involved in making the decision. A morally good decision is one that is based on the virtuous character of whoever is making the decision. ... WebMay 25, 2024 · Ethical marketing is an extension of ethics —which is defined as a system of moral principles. Put simply, ethical marketing is when you promote a product, service, or brand in a way that aligns with your values and morals. This can mean not making inflated claims, as well as practicing full transparency and openness.
